71. Andre Norman: Spending 14 Years in Prison to Changing the World

“I know people in the world today who aren’t free. They’re slaves to work, they’re slaves to stereotypes and slaves to cultures and customs they don’t even believe in. Not being in jail does not mean you are free.” This week’s guest is proof that your past doesn’t have to equal your future. You can drop the old stories, change your core beliefs, and create a life you love - even if your past says otherwise.Rewind two decades and not only was Andre serving a 100-year prison sentence, he also ran all the gang activity in the prison. You could say it was his destiny. As a kid, he felt unwanted. He felt disconnected and left out. In turn, he never saw his potential and instead followed a life fuelled by drugs, alcohol, depression, self-harming, and ultimately crime.But as is the case with many people, once he hit rock bottom he was able to turn his life around.It was during a period of solitary confinement that Andre eventually pulled the metaphorical parachute for help. His epiphany inspired him to do the work, and after serving just 14 years, he was free.But more than claiming his physical liberty, Andre also reclaimed his mind to take back full control of his life.Now, Andre’s life is one of impact and giving back. His mission is teaching individuals and corporations how to turn any situation around. His innovative strategies against gang activity and inmate manipulation have also improved correctional facilities across the U.S. He’s an all-round inspirational dude with an impactful and powerful story to share.Can’t wait for you to hear it.“Everything that takes you down helps you come up.”Andre is the man! I was so inspired to discover the strategies and mindsets that enabled him to turn his life around in the most extraordinary way. 70. Cathryn Lavery: Transitioning from Employee to Multi-Millionaire Founder

“If everyone did the same thing as everyone else, then no one would be creating an impact.” It was 2011 when Cathryn Lavery moved from Ireland to New York City to take up a graduate job as an architect. Despite dabbling with an Ebay store while at school, there was no question of her not following a traditional career path. And anyway, she didn’t know any entrepreneurs to guide her.But life had other plans.When Cathryn landed in NYC, her employer announced a 25% cut in her pay. Cathryn wasn’t ready to quit or admit to her parents that things weren’t working out as expected, so she launched a side hustle to help make ends meet.Before long that side hustle generated more money than her full-time job. After reading 23 carefully selected books and completing her ‘personal MBA’, Cathryn quit to become a full-time entrepreneur - and never looked back.Today, Cathryn is the CEO and creative genius behind BestSelf.Co - a multi-million-dollar ecommerce brand that develops tools (such as the SELF Journal) to help people live their best lives.With BestSelf.Co, Cathryn won Shopify’s Build a Business and Build a Bigger Business Awards and got mentored by the likes of Tony Robbins and Tim Ferriss. 69. Lee Holden: How to Become Superhuman

“There is a way in which we can ask good questions, and I think that is the bridge I often use to help people discover these latent powers within themselves and their own human potential.” What do you do if you feel pain in your body? If you’re like a lot of people, then your instinct will be to reach for the painkillers. But what if that’s not the right thing to do?Our western culture is very cerebral. We spend a lot of time in our heads, while ignoring the calling of our body. It can be hard to express emotions and even more difficult to process them. As a result, we experience a lot of dis-ease.Today’s guest has a different approach. After a back injury while playing college football, Lee Holden was told he’d be out for the rest of the season. He took pain medication, but when the pills affected his digestion he sought a different route for healing. To his surprise, acupuncture made him better after just a few weeks and he was back in the team faster than anyone predicted. This profound healing experience reignited Lee’s passion for understanding energy and inspired him to practice Qi Gong.Qi Gong is a mind, body, spirit practice that helps us reconnect with our life force by opening the flow of the energy meridians. Through a combination of posture, movement, breathing, sound, and focus, Qi Gong can help us deal with stress and dis-ease. Lee has practiced Qi Gong for over 25 years and helped over 10,000 students feel less stressed and more energetic. Working with the energy of the ‘three treasures’ (the mind, body, and heart), Lee’s work empowers people to live their happiest, most vibrant, most fulfilled lives. 67. Todd Herman: Using Alter Egos To Experience The Life You Want

“An alter ego gives you an amazing tool to tap into the creative imagination to allow you to unfold and see more of what you’re capable of.”This episode’s guest is an absolute rockstar. I picked up his new book a few weeks back and finished it within 2 days - which should be telling for the greatness that was shared here.Mr Todd Herman is a peak performance coach and serial entrepreneur who’s been mentoring elite performers in the world of sport and business for over 20 years. Through his treasure box of tools and philosophies, Todd is known for helping people achieve their most ambitious goals.And in this episode, you’ll discover one of his most powerful techniques - so you can use it for yourself.The technique I’m referring to is the use of an “alter ego”, which comes from Todd’s new book - The Alter Ego Effect.Alter egos are the “other you”. They are characters (or identities) you can ‘activate’ to demonstrate the mindsets, beliefs, and practices that enable you to take the actions required to achieve your goals.In this way, alter egos are a tool that give you enough confidence to overcome resistance and get momentum going.It’s how they can help you achieve really hard things.So if you know that there’s more in your tank and you get frustrated because willpower isn’t enough to take you over the threshold, you definitely want to listen to this episode.Understand the superhero effect of alter egos and you’ll empower yourself to achieve your most ambitious goals.“An alter ego for many people is often there to help you get past that initial resistance you may be having around pursuing something that’s new.”In this episode you’ll discover:What becomes possible for you and your life when you play with your alter egosHow ‘activating’ alter egos connects you with the same creative imagination that makes children believe they can be supermanWhy it’s healthier and more advantageous to be able to access multiple ‘selves’ rather than stick with a single identityHow Todd used an alter ego to manage his daughter’s tantrums (this is a must-hear technique for any parent!)The relationship between your ‘trapped self’ and your ‘heroic self’ (and how your alter egos help you shift from one to the other)What I loved most about this interview is the notion that the person you want to be is already inside.Todd explains that you’re not broken and you don’t need to be fixed. Instead, you simply need to chisel away at all the ‘stuff’ that isn’t you.
